Hey Priya,

Wrapping up my shift on the Terraquill field-survey app. Offline mode is mostly stable now — sync queue flushes correctly after reconnect, but there's still a flaky conflict-merge case when two surveyors edit the same plot record. I left repro steps in the runbook under "offline-merge." Nothing urgent for the release manager yet, but flag it before the Kestrel 2.4 cut. If anything blows up overnight, reach me here.

escalation mailbox, yajeg-bageg: quenax.olidor@lumiccorp.internal

Minutes — Management Meeting, Second-Source Supplier Search. Present: T. Abrell, J. Moxham, K. Serret. The group confirmed that reliance on Vontara Components for the actuator line remains the top supply risk. Three candidate suppliers were shortlisted; site audits begin next month. J. Moxham will own qualification timelines and cost comparisons. The preferred sourcing strategy agreed at the meeting is noted below.

board note of baguf-fafog: Kasixox Foods plans to lower the Drueth list price by 48 percent in March.

During the Brindleport incident, the Gaugewell metrics-aggregation sidecar buffered past its high-water mark and dropped 11 minutes of counters. Root cause: flush interval too long for burst traffic from the Ostrey ingest tier.

Support impact: dashboards showed flat lines, not outages. If customers report missing graphs between deploys, check sidecar buffer depth before escalating.

Fix ships next patch. Until then, apply the override manually on affected hosts. Use these tuning constants when patching:

tuning table, yajog-yahof:
BUDGETS = {
    "lamvan": 303,
    "wenox": 460,
    "fenvan": 525,
}

Hey future maintainers! Sproutly (our plant-watering scheduler) gets built by the Greenhaus pipeline, which pins every dependency down to the exact moss-sensor firmware blob. Each release bundles a provenance manifest: who triggered it, which branch of the Tendril repo it came from, and the container digest used. If a pump misfires at 3am, start with the manifest before blaming the hardware. Honestly, it's saved us twice already. For quick reference, the token for the currently deployed build appears here.

pipeline stamp: htk3_69f